Along with the rapid development of the economy and the improvement of people's living standards in China,health care industry ushers in a golden opportunity for development. Furthermore, the fast growth of industry production value and industry scale gives a hint of the potential for the health care industry. According to incomplete statistics of Chinese health care association, the production value of Chinese health care industry in 2006, 2007 and 2008 are 550 billion Yuan, 600 billion Yuan and 800 billion Yuan respectively; the number of health care companies is almost 3000 and there are more than 3 million Employees in health care industry. However, with the flourish of health care industry,many serious problems of management which hinder the health care companies'development have been exposed such as inefficient management of retailer, ineffective restraint and motivation of employees, improper control of capital and production.This paper firstly summarizes the theories of performance management, and analyzes development process of Chinese health care industry and its characteristics of incentive and evaluation mechanism. Based on above study and analysis of problem on incentive mechanism and performance management of company A, a complete system of performance management is established for Company A from the perspective of human resources management. According to the implement and effect of performance planning, performance assessment and performance feedback, this new performance management system has a significantly incentive effect which raise employees'real enthusiasm and increase their satisfaction and senses of belonging.
